← Комьюнити

Как правильно обратится к некоторым элементам с помощью псевдокласса?

Виктор Хомченко4 ответов

Здравствуйте, при подключении псевдокласса nth-child срабатывает только child(1).  (4) и (6) не работают. Не пойму где ошибка.

li:nth-child(1){
	padding-left: 16px;
}
li:nth-child(4){
	padding-left: 30px;
}
li:nth-child(6){
	padding-left: 70px;
}

4 ответов

Принятый ответ

Спискам нужно добавит class и потом к ним можно обращаться по названию класса

student_O30taCFT1
Принятый ответ

Значит в html где-то ошибся, может <li> где-то не закрыт и т.д. 

student_O30taCFT

Я понял в чем проблема, у меня два  разных списка UL. Обращаясь к первому элементу li  из первого списка, псевдокласс обращается и ко второму. Но как обратится, конкретно к элементам из второго списка UL?

Виктор Хомченко

Да, для второго UL можно создать отдельный класс, но я хочу обратится именно через псевдо,что бы понять как они работают. 

Виктор Хомченко